Cosmetic Procedures: FSA and HSA Eligibility
Generally, cosmetic procedures are ineligible unless the treatment or procedure is medically necessary. However, some cases are taken into consideration if the cosmetic treatment is meant to improve a personal injury, congenital abnormality or disfiguring disease.

Are any cosmetic procedures covered by FSA?

FSA Guidelines on Cosmetic Surgery

Because plastic surgery is typically not used to treat a medical condition, it is not considered an FSA eligible expense. Any changes to appearance without a valid medical reason are not reimbursable.

Can I use my FSA for lipo?

Cosmetic procedures (e.g. facelift, Botox, hair transplants, liposuction, teeth whitening) are usually ineligible, unless the procedure is necessary to improve a deformity due to a congenital abnormality, personal injury or disfiguring disease.

Can you use FSA for breast lift?

IRS regulations stipulate that FSA's can only be used to offset the cost of a plastic surgery procedure that is designed to: Treat congenital (birth) defects. Address issues related to a chronic disease. Achieve a medical reconstruction following some type of accident.

Can FSA pay for gym?

Yes, it could — if you prove the expense is medically necessary. General fitness expenses don't qualify for HSA/FSA use, but things change when a physician or nurse practitioner prescribes an exercise regimen. For example, a physician might prescribe weight training or aerobic activity to lower blood pressure.

Are weight-loss injections FSA eligible?

Like any other health care product, you're only able to use your FSA funds for a weight loss program if the purpose is to treat, mitigate, cure, diagnose or prevent a specific illness. This condition needs to be diagnosed by a physician and may include conditions such as obesity, heart disease and hypertension.

Are Apple watches FSA eligible?

Understanding What's Eligible and What's Not

While fitness trackers such as an Apple Watch, Fitbit or Garmin aren't eligible expenses, medical devices that monitor, screen, or test for certain diseases or medical conditions may be eligible. These include items like blood pressure and heart-rate monitors.
